The article presents different economic aspects of the implementation of non-verbal analysis programs and makes recommendations for their introduction in airport security, it outlines the opportunities for financial investment and the important issues to be taken into consideration. The aim of the research is to outline the importance of behavioral analysis in the field of airport infrastructure. The problematic area of this subject is provoked by the continuous increase of the risks and threats to the airport infrastructure and the necessity of modern and innovative methods to overcome them. In recent years, the non-verbal analyses have become more and more important for the economic, social and political relations, as well as for different aspects of security.References
